Johanna
//d͡ʒəʊˈænə// name
Definitions
Proper Noun
- 1 A female given name from Latin.
- 2 The Comoros island of Anjouan. historical
"The commanders agreed to continue together, and put into Johanna for supplies of water and fresh provisions."
- 3 A locality in the Shire of Colac Otway, south western Victoria, Australia
Etymology
From Latin Johanna, variant of Joanna, from Koine Greek Ἰωάννα (Iōánna), from Hebrew יוֹחָנָה (Yôḥānāh, literally “God is gracious”), the feminized form of יְהוֹחָנָן (Yəhōḥānān) which produced John and its many doublets. Doublet of Ivana, Jana, Jane, Janice, Janis, Jean, Jeanne, Jen, Joan, Joanna, Joanne, Juana, Shavonne, Sian, Siobhan, Shane, Shaun, Shauna, Sheena, and Zhanna.
